I lived in bham for 4 years, and have spent a lot of time in the other places.
Birmingham is not New Orleans (which may be a good thing), but is a beautiful city with a young vibe. The restaurant scene is getting better every day.
Another practical thing to consider in retirement is access to healthcare. UAB is somewhat under the radar compared to other healthcare destinations, but is truly one of the best in the nation.
